how to prepare for your tattoo appointment

1. Get Enough Rest

  • Sleep well the night before your appointment. Being well-rested helps your body heal and manage pain better.

2. Eat a Good Meal

  • Eat a healthy, balanced meal before your appointment. A full stomach can help keep your energy up and prevent fainting or feeling lightheaded during the tattoo.

3. Stay Hydrated

  • Drink plenty of water the day before and the morning of your tattoo session. Hydration is always very important.

4. Bring a Fizzy Drink and Some Sweets

  • Bring a fizzy drink and some sweets to help keep your blood sugar levels stable during the session. This is especially helpful if you're getting a larger tattoo or have concerns about feeling lightheaded or weak.

5. Avoid Alcohol and Drugs

  • Avoid alcohol, caffeine, or any recreational drugs for at least 24 hours before your appointment. Alcohol is a blood thinner, which may increase bleeding during the tattoo process and affect the quality of your tattoo well as your decision making.

6. Wear Comfortable Clothing

  • Wear loose, comfortable clothing that allows easy access to the area being tattooed. If your tattoo is on your arm or leg, wear something like a short-sleeve shirt or shorts.

  • Make sure you’re comfortable and can relax during the session.

7. Do Not Shave the Area

  • Do not shave the area where your tattoo will be applied. Shaving could cause irritation or a rash, and this may lead to your appointment needing to be rescheduled. I will take care of shaving the area before starting the tattoo.

8. Avoid Sun Exposure

  • Avoid sunburns or tanning before your tattoo. Sunburned skin is more sensitive, which can make the tattooing process more painful and can affect how the tattoo heals.

9. Bring a Valid ID

  • Bring a valid ID to your appointment. This will be checked before starting your tattoo. You must be over 18 to get tattooed.
